Four houses damaged; woman, son hurt (State of Odisha, India)
The Daily Pioneer
February 15, 2021

A male elephant from Sambalpur forests has created havoc  in Chandnimal and
Tareikela villages under Kolabira Range here. Besides eating vegetables,
the elephant damaged four houses injuring a woman and her son.

On Thursday night, the elephant entered the Chandnimal village and damaged
house of one Suresh Khadia and Sankirtan Khadia eating their rice stock.
When the family members woke up and raised alarm, the elephant fled. But,
Suresh's wife Sumita and son Sakti got head injuries when a wall collapsed
on them while sleeping.

Then, the elephant damaged the vegetables of Bikram Banchor and while
trying to  break open the door of the house, the villagers got alert and
chased away the elephant by producing noise.

Being informed, forest officers reached the village to trace the elephant.
But, the elephant then had entered the Tareikela village and dragged a rice
bag breaking a wall of a house of Laxmi Rout. When the villagers created
noise the elephant fled to Mahulmunda forest.
